Rep. Tom Barrett urges the Armed Services Committee to include his legislation in the National Defense Authorization Act.

Congressman Barrett urges legislative inclusion: On April 15, 2026, Congressman Tom Barrett called for the inclusion of three of his proposed bills in the National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A) during a testimony to the House Armed Services Committee. These bills focus on aviation safety and the restoration of educational benefits for servicemembers affected by the COVID-19 vaccine mandate.
Details on proposed legislation: Barrett emphasized the need for safety reforms in aviation to prevent future tragedies, referencing a midair collision incident. He also highlighted the importance of restoring G.I. benefits for servicemembers who were involuntarily discharged due to their vaccination status, stating, “...we need to fix it, and we can do that.”
Legislative background: Barrett's proposals include the Military ADS-B Out Loophole Act and the Safety in Shared Skies Act, aimed at enhancing aviation safety. Additionally, the Patriots Over Politics Act seeks to allow certain servicemembers to transfer their G.I. benefits to their children, addressing injustices stemming from the recent vaccine mandate.

Tom Barrett Fundraising
Tom Barrett recently disclosed $947.0K of fundraising in a Q4 FEC disclosure filed on January 31st, 2026. This was the 70th most from all Q4 reports we have seen this year. 65.3% came from individual donors.
Barrett disclosed $609.3K of spending. This was the 92nd most from all Q4 reports we have seen from politicians so far this year.
Barrett disclosed $2.2M of cash on hand at the end of the filing period. This was the 192nd most from all Q4 reports we have seen this year.

2026 Michigan's 7th Congressional District Election
There has been approximately $59,671,641 of spending in Michigan's 7th congressional district elections over the last two years, per our estimates.
Approximately $44,089,090 of this has been from outside spending by PACs and Super PACs. Some of the groups who are spending money in this race include:
- HMP ($15,842,498)
- CONGRESSIONAL LEADERSHIP FUND ($10,324,478)
- DCCC ($5,504,330)
- NRCC ($4,761,823)
- AMERICANS FOR PROSPERITY ACTION, INC. (AFP ACTION) DBA CVA ACTION AND DBA LIBRE ACTION ($1,898,483)
The rating for this race is currently "Toss Up".
